Why is the serial dilution method utilized to dilute bacterial samples?

Answer
The serial dilution method is utilized to dilute bacterial samples to obtain a countable number of colonies for accurate quantification.
Solution
a
Gradual Dilution: Serial dilution involves diluting a sample in a stepwise manner, which allows for a controlled and measurable reduction in concentration
b
Countable Range: By performing serial dilutions, the bacterial concentration can be reduced to a level that falls within a countable range for colony-forming units (CFUs) on an agar plate
c
Accuracy and Precision: This method provides a reliable way to estimate the original concentration of bacteria in a sample by counting colonies from dilutions that yield 30-300 colonies, which is considered statistically significant for accurate quantification
d
Safety: It reduces the risk of handling highly concentrated bacterial cultures, which can be hazardous
Key Concept
Serial dilution is a method to systematically reduce the concentration of a bacterial sample for accurate quantification.
Explanation
Serial dilution is used because it allows for precise control over the dilution process, ensuring that the bacterial concentration is reduced to a level that is both safe to handle and within a countable range for accurate measurement of bacterial numbers.
